Falafel is traditionally a Middle Eastern dish made from ground chickpeas or fava beans, but with the help of an air fryer, we can streamline the process while still achieving that golden crispiness. Ingredients List
To create the most delightful 20 Minute Air Fryer Falafel, you’ll need the following ingredients:
- 1 can (15 oz) chickpeas, drained and rinsed
- 1 small onion, roughly chopped
- 2 cloves garlic
- 1/4 cup fresh parsley, chopped
- 1/4 cup fresh cilantro, chopped
- 1 teaspoon cumin
- 1 teaspoon coriander
- 1/2 teaspoon baking powder
- Salt and pepper, to taste
- 1 tablespoon olive oil (or a halal alternative)
- 1/4 cup flour (gluten-free or chickpea flour for alternatives)
Step-by-Step Instructions
Now, let’s get cooking! With just a few simple steps, you can whip up a batch of these scrumptious falafels in no time.
Prepare the Chickpeas: In a food processor, combine the drained chickpeas, chopped onion, garlic, parsley, cilantro, cumin, coriander, baking powder, salt, and pepper. Pulse until the mixture is coarsely blended but not pureed.
Form the Mixture: Transfer the mixture to a bowl and stir in the flour until combined. This will help bind the falafels. Taste and adjust seasonings as needed.
Shape the Falafel: Scoop out about two tablespoons of the mixture and roll them into balls or flatten them slightly into patties. You should get about 10-12 falafel pieces from this recipe.
Preheat the Air Fryer: Preheat your air fryer to 375°F (190°C). This quick step is essential for achieving that golden brown exterior.
Air Fry the Falafel: Spray or lightly coat the falafel with olive oil. Place the falafel in the air fryer basket in a single layer, ensuring they aren’t overcrowded. Air fry for 10-12 minutes, flipping halfway through, until they’re crispy and golden.
Serve and Enjoy: Once cooked, serve the falafel warm with your favorite dips like tahini or yogurt sauce, alongside fresh vegetables or in pita bread.
Tips for Success
Don’t Overmix: When blending the ingredients, aim for a coarse texture. Overprocessing can lead to a paste-like consistency, which won’t hold up well during frying.
Chill the Mixture: For extra structure, consider chilling the falafel mixture for 30 minutes before shaping. This will help them maintain their shape during cooking.
Spray for Crisp: Giving the falafel a light spray of oil before frying helps achieve that desired crispy texture without the extra calories.

Storage Recommendations
Refrigeration: Store leftover falafel in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at in the air fryer for a few minutes to regain crispiness.
Freezing: You can also freeze uncooked falafel balls. Place them on a baking sheet in a single layer until frozen, then transfer to a freezer-safe bag. When ready to enjoy, cook from frozen; just add a few extra minutes to the cooking time.

FAQs
1. Can I use dried chickpeas instead of canned?
Yes! If using dried chickpeas, soak them overnight and cook them until tender before using them in the falafel mixture.
2. Can I add more vegetables to the falafel mixture?
Absolutely! Diced bell peppers or grated carrots can add flavor and nutrition to your falafel—just make sure to adjust the flour to maintain consistency.
3. How do I know when the falafel is cooked through?
The falafel should be golden brown and crispy on the outside. A slight crispness indicates that they’ve cooked through properly.
4. What are the best dipping sauces for falafel?
Some popular options include tahini sauce, yogurt sauce, or a spicy harissa dip for an extra kick!
